Noun [Malay]

IPA: /suˈsila/ (note: Literary Standard), [suˈsi.la] (note: Literary Standard) Forms: سوسيلا [Jawi]
Rhymes: -la, -a Etymology: Derived from Sanskrit सुशील (suśīla, “gentleman-like”) of सु- (su-, “good”) + शील (śīla, “conduct”).
